Home Rule Proposal 1
Shall the Radnor Township Home Rule Charter be amended to: 1) require that all township records and reports be prominently posted on the Township's website, and to permit individual Commissioners to add items to the Board agenda; 2) provide that new ward lines be drawn within 10 months after each Decennial U.S. Census Report; 3) establish a Vacancy Board to fill vacancies in the Office of Commissioner; and 4) provide for suspension or removal of at-will department heads and township employees by the Township Manager, subject to Board approval. | Radnor Township | ||
YES | 1,648 | ||
NO | 317 | ||
Home Rule Proposal 2
Shall the Radnor Township Home Rule Charter be amended to: 1) provide that the elected Township Treasurer shall have general oversight of receipts, disbursements and tax collection in the township; 2) provide the Treasurer with additional authority to access all financial accounts and reports upon request and be permitted to make oral presentations and an annual written report to the Township Board of Commissioners and Township residents concerning any irregularities, deficiencies, abuse or illegal acts pertaining to the overall finances of the Township; and 3) provide for a revised surcharge procedure with specific authority to file any surcharge amount in the Delaware County Office of Judicial Support. | Radnor Township | ||
YES | 1,633 | ||
NO | 313 | ||
Home Rule Proposal 3
Shall the Radnor Township Home Rule Charter be amended to: 1) revise the procedure for a proposed, recommended and adopted comprehensive budget, consisting of a proposed operating budget and proposed three-year capital program following generally accepted accounting principles; 2) establish a new timeline for adoption of the comprehensive budget, including public notice and public hearing requirements; and 3) provide for a quarterly budget review by the Township Manager. | Radnor Township | ||
YES | 1,741 | ||
NO | 185 | ||
Home Rule Proposal 4
Shall the Radnor Township Home Rule Charter be amended to: 1) revise the contract procedure to authorize the Township Manager to approve contracts involving expenditures not exceeding $7,500; 2) require expenditures exceeding $7,500 to be approved publicly by the Board of Commissioners; 3) require public advertising and public bidding procedures be met for expenditures of $25,000 and above; and 4) provide for a procedure to permit emergency expenditures without the Board of Commissioners' prior approval and to permit the future adjustment of the dollar limitations for expenditures to reflect inflation upon an affirmative vote of two-thirds of the Commissioners. | Radnor Township | ||
YES | 1,573 | ||
NO | 307 | ||
